Beech Grove is an excluded city in Marion County, Indiana, United States. As of the 2010 census, the city’s population is 14,192. The city is located within the Indianapolis metropolitan area.
According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 4.39 square miles (11.37 km2), all land.[9]

Nevertheless, your a/c unit is most likely to develop problems with time due to the fact that of reasons such as lack of appropriate upkeep, consistent usage, and changing weather condition all resulting in the breakdown of the cooling home appliance.
If an aircon conditioner is leaking, it leads to included tension since the home appliance stops working to work properly and therefore, fails to offer you and your household the appropriate cooling that you require to stand up to the heat. This problem, a bane to the presence of many air conditioning system owners, can be attributed to several factors.

There are several causes that cause the leaking and leaking of an aircon. Here are a number of possible culprits: Air leak is among the most common factors that might lead to the air conditioning unit dripping and dripping water. For optimum function, the air reaching the air conditioner ought to pass through the vent.
The air does not pass through the vent as it should. If this does not happen, probably the air is dripping which causes suboptimal performance. To confirm whether you’re experiencing an air leak, you need to do basic troubleshooting by taking a look at the equipment to see if there is leak of air through the grates around the vent.
This is yet another typical factor for an air conditioner leaking and dripping water. When the air filter becomes blocked, it prevents the flow of air through the system. This will lead to freezing of the air, and when you turn off the aircon or when the wanted air temperature is reached, ice formed on the filter starts melting.
If the air filter is clogged or dirty, air flow to the evaporator gets blocked, therefore causing a drop in temperature level. If the coil ends up being too cold, it freezes. When the aircon is turned off, the indoor system will stop sucking air to the interior, which then causes warming and leads to the melting of accumulated ice.
The condensation pump is a device situated below the cooling coil. The function of the pump is to drain out water thoroughly so that leakage is avoided. When the pump is broken or is malfunctioning since of the accumulation of dust and dirt, it leads to water dripping a clear indicator that the pump is not working effectively.
